The one decent (but expensive!) experience is the Palmer Motorsport Experience: https://www.palmersport.com/ it is way beyond all others...

Many of the alternatives will limit what you are allowed to do in the car / how many laps etc. and often the cars are fairly knackered...

I did do this experience: https://www.forsterracingschool.co.uk/driving-experience/rage-buggy-goodwood/ with Rage buggies (very fast off-road buggies) with my 13yr old godson - and for child and adult it was superb... (but a long way from you)

Land Rover Experiences are meant to be good - though again, very controlled... they are around the country...

but I don't know of a good supercar experience - and I am fairly heavily involved in the car world... a post on somewhere like pistonheads.com might help?
